Udhampur:  Railway authorities yesterday conducted successful trial run of a train on 25-km-long Udhampur-Katra track, which will improve connectivity to the base camp of Mata Vaishnodevi cave shrine.


“Test run of train on Udhampur-Katra track has been conducted yesterday.

It was successful,” a senior police officer said.

General Manager, Northern Railways, D K Gupta was on board a special train with 14 boggies during the test run.  

The direct rail connectivity to Katra, the base camp for the Vaishno Devi shrine, will become a reality for passengers after its inauguration any time in January next year, sources said.

Earlier, the authorities had conducted a trial on December 7 when a light power engine was run from Udhampur to Katra.

The GM on reaching Udhampur station went through the station to check all required necessities to open the Udhampur-Katra track and later left for Katra station through special train.

After going through regular test runs, being conducted to ensure safety of passengers, the track is ready to be thrown open.

A senior Railway's official said on condition of anonymity that a VVIP is likely to inaugurate the service by the beginning of next year.

“Though no date has been finalised officially, it is  mostly likely that the train service will be operational in  January,” he said.
